Waves crash against the shore as I stand watching the horizon.
What are you looking for little one?
Tears cascade down my face, as the wind caresses my face.
Why are you crying little one?
The sandy shore is changed every time I come here for solitude, just as my own life changes, not always for the better.
Why don't you call for me little one? Ask me for help?
Blindly each day passes, still searching for the way
Why don't you look for me little one?
The days are all the same, and yet each one seems worse.
What are you searching for little one?
Cautiously I take a step toward THE way!
Don't be cautious little one!
I enter His house, waiting for disapproval.
I am here little one.
Sitting down, I face a sea of unfamiliar faces,
How do you feel little one?
The sense of warmth and belonging linger around me.
How do you feel little one?
I feel as if I have come home.
You did little one!
